Terrestrial Hydrosphere Data Access and Tools

NASA data examine many characteristics of the liquid and frozen water and the dynamic processes they are part of across Earth’s landscape. Our datasets and tools help researchers translate these interconnected data points into actionable knowledge.

Terrestrial Hydrosphere Data Tools

Tool Sort descending Description Services
ASF MapReady Terrain-correct, geocode, and apply polarimetric decompositions to multi-pol SAR data Processing
CASEI The Catalog of Archived Suborbital Earth Science Investigations (CASEI) is a comprehensive inventory of contextual information for NASA's Earth Science airborne and field campaigns. Search and Discovery, Cataloging
CyAN File Search The CyAN File Search tool allows users to choose an area over the continental United States and Alaska to retrieve cyanobacteria datasets archived by the Cyanobacteria Assessment Network (CyAN) project. Analysis, Search and Discovery, Visualization
Earthdata Search Earthdata Search enables data discovery, search, comparison, visualization, and access across NASA’s Earth science data holdings. Search and Discovery, Access, Cataloging, Cloud Computing, Downloading
Hydrocron Hydrocron is an API that repackages hydrology datasets from SWOT into formats that make time-series analysis easier. Subsetting, Visualization
Panoply Panoply is a cross-platform application that plots geo-referenced and other arrays from netCDF, HDF, GRIB, and other datasets. Visualization, Customization, Reformatting, Subsetting, Comparison
RTC Stack Processor The radiometric terrain correction (RTC) stack processor tool facilitates time-series analysis of such phenomena as flooding events, deforestation, or glacier retreat. Analysis, Processing, Search and Discovery, Visualization
SeaDAS Sea, earth, atmosphere Data Analysis System (SeaDAS) is a comprehensive image analysis package for the processing, display, analysis, and quality control of ocean color data. Analysis, Visualization, Processing
STREAM STREAM is a rapid water quality monitoring tool that processes satellite imagery to create maps showing chlorophyll-a, Total Suspended Solids, and water clarity at 20-30 meter resolution. Processing
SWOT Swath Visualizer The Surface Water and Ocean Topography (SWOT) Swath Visualizer provides a visualization of two instruments’ coverage of Earth's surface: the Ka-band Radar Interferometer and altimeter. Analysis, Data Curation, Visualization
